Regulators Approve Merger of Windstream, EarthLink

Windstream Holdings Inc. of Little Rock announced Tuesday that it has received all state and federal regulatory approvals required for its merger with EarthLink Holdings Corp. of Atlanta.

The companies will hold special meetings with their respective stockholders on Feb. 24 in connection with the merger, which is expected to close in the first quarter.

Windstream also announced that it will hold a conference call at 7:30 a.m. March 1 to review its fourth-quarter and full-year 2016 earnings results. The call will also be streamed live on the company's website.

Windstream and Earthlink announced the merger in November, and their agreement includes an all-stock deal valued at about $1.1 billion, including debt.
